The crisis within the Lagos State House of Assembly has escalated as embattled Speaker Mojisola Meranda maintains that she remains the legitimate Speaker despite Mudashiru Obasa’s dramatic return to the Assembly complex.…….READ MORE
Speaking through her Special Adviser on Information, Victor Ganzallo, on Sunday, Meranda downplayed Obasa’s occupation of the Speaker’s office, insisting that it does not undermine her authority or ability to carry out her duties.
Obasa, who was removed as Speaker on January 13, 2025, staged a dramatic return to the Assembly complex last Thursday, arriving with security operatives. Around 9 a.m., he reportedly took over the Speaker’s office and proceeded to hold a plenary session with only four lawmakers, an action swiftly rejected by 35 other members of the House.
Lawmakers had removed Obasa over allegations of abuse of office, financial misappropriation, and misconduct, triggering a leadership battle that has only intensified. However, Obasa insists that his removal was illegal and unconstitutional, vowing to reclaim his position.
Reacting to Obasa’s move, Meranda strongly condemned his attempt to reclaim the seat, calling it a “show of shame.”
“Obasa is still a member of the Assembly, so he has the right to be present. However, breaking into my office is unacceptable,” Meranda said after a court session in Ikeja.
On Obasa’s plenary session with only four lawmakers, she remarked:
“That was nothing more than a staged drama. Our legislative process requires a quorum. Holding a session with just a handful of lawmakers is a mockery of the system.”
Despite Obasa taking over the Speaker’s office, Meranda’s camp remains firm and defiant.
Her spokesperson, Ganzallo, dismissed concerns about Obasa’s actions, emphasizing that leadership is determined by lawmakers’ support, not by physically occupying an office.
“The case is in court, and 35 members still recognize Meranda as Speaker,” he stated. “An office is just a workplace—true leadership comes from the backing of the majority.”
Efforts by the ruling All Progressives Congress (APC) to resolve the crisis have so far failed. A mediation panel led by Chief Bisi Akande and Aremo Olusegun Osoba, initiated by President Bola Tinubu, has been unable to broker peace between the two factions.
Despite this, Lagos APC Chairman, Cornelius Ojelabi, assured that a resolution was imminent.
“This is an internal party matter, and we will resolve it soon. The party has the capacity to handle it,” Ojelabi stated.
The Governance Advisory Council (GAC), the highest decision-making body of the Lagos APC, has criticized lawmakers for removing Obasa without first consulting the party.
GAC Chairman, Chief Tajudeen Olusi, revealed that neither the party nor the GAC was involved in the decision to remove Obasa.
“The lawmakers acted without consulting the party and key stakeholders,” Olusi stated.
He further emphasized that lawmakers do not have absolute authority to impeach or install leaders without input from the party, adding:
“No one can become a member of the House of Assembly without party sponsorship. The party remains the key stakeholder in leadership decisions.”
